次の方法で共有


ServerAuditSpecificationExtender クラス

メソッドとプロパティを ServerAuditSpecification オブジェクトに追加します。

この API は、CLS に準拠していません。 CLS に準拠する代替が必要な場合は、[false] を使用してください。

継承階層

System.Object
  Microsoft.SqlServer.Management.Sdk.Sfc.SfcObjectExtender<ServerAuditSpecification>
    Microsoft.SqlServer.Management.Smo.SmoObjectExtender<ServerAuditSpecification>
      Microsoft.SqlServer.Management.Smo.ServerAuditSpecificationExtender

名前空間:  Microsoft.SqlServer.Management.Smo
アセンブリ:  Microsoft.SqlServer.Smo (Microsoft.SqlServer.Smo.dll)

構文

'宣言
<CLSCompliantAttribute(False)> _
Public Class ServerAuditSpecificationExtender _
    Inherits SmoObjectExtender(Of ServerAuditSpecification) _
    Implements ISfcValidate
'使用
Dim instance As ServerAuditSpecificationExtender
[CLSCompliantAttribute(false)]
public class ServerAuditSpecificationExtender : SmoObjectExtender<ServerAuditSpecification>, 
    ISfcValidate
[CLSCompliantAttribute(false)]
public ref class ServerAuditSpecificationExtender : public SmoObjectExtender<ServerAuditSpecification^>, 
    ISfcValidate
[<CLSCompliantAttribute(false)>]
type ServerAuditSpecificationExtender =  
    class 
        inherit SmoObjectExtender<ServerAuditSpecification>
        interface ISfcValidate 
    end
public class ServerAuditSpecificationExtender extends SmoObjectExtender<ServerAuditSpecification> implements ISfcValidate

ServerAuditSpecificationExtender 型は、以下のメンバーを公開しています。

コンストラクター

  名前 説明
パブリック メソッド ServerAuditSpecificationExtender() メソッドとプロパティを既定のプロパティ値で ServerAuditSpecification オブジェクトに追加します。
パブリック メソッド ServerAuditSpecificationExtender(ServerAuditSpecification) メソッドとプロパティを指定された ServerAuditSpecification オブジェクトに追加します。

先頭に戻る

プロパティ

  名前 説明
パブリック プロパティ Audits サーバー エクステンダー内のオブジェクトのコレクションを取得します。
パブリック プロパティ AuditSpecificationDetails 監査後の仕様の詳細を取得します。値の設定も可能です。
パブリック プロパティ ConnectionContext ServerAuditSpecification オブジェクトの接続コンテキストを返します。
パブリック プロパティ DatabaseName 指定したデータベースの名前を取得します。
パブリック プロパティ GridValidationState 検証の現在の状態を取得します。値の設定も可能です。
プロテクト プロパティ Parent このメンバーをコード内で直接参照しないでください。このメンバーは、SQL Server インフラストラクチャをサポートしています。 (SfcObjectExtender<TSfcInstance> から継承されています。)
パブリック プロパティ State ServerAuditSpecification オブジェクトの状態を返します。
パブリック プロパティ Type ServerAuditSpecification オブジェクトの種類を取得します。

先頭に戻る

メソッド

  名前 説明
パブリック メソッド Equals (Object から継承されています。)
プロテクト メソッド Finalize (Object から継承されています。)
パブリック メソッド GetHashCode (Object から継承されています。)
プロテクト メソッド GetParentSfcPropertySet 親オブジェクトのプロパティのセットのインスタンスを返します。 (SmoObjectExtender<T> から継承されています。)
パブリック メソッド GetPropertySet このメンバーをコード内で直接参照しないでください。このメンバーは、SQL Server インフラストラクチャをサポートしています。 (SfcObjectExtender<TSfcInstance> から継承されています。)
パブリック メソッド GetType (Object から継承されています。)
プロテクト メソッド MemberwiseClone (Object から継承されています。)
プロテクト メソッド OnPropertyChanged サブスクライバーがある場合に PropertyChanged イベントを発生させます。このメンバーをコード内で直接参照しないでください。このメンバーは、SQL Server インフラストラクチャをサポートしています。 (SfcObjectExtender<TSfcInstance> から継承されています。)
プロテクト メソッド OnPropertyMetadataChanged このメンバーをコード内で直接参照しないでください。このメンバーは、SQL Server インフラストラクチャをサポートしています。 (SfcObjectExtender<TSfcInstance> から継承されています。)
プロテクト メソッド parent_PropertyChanged このメンバーをコード内で直接参照しないでください。このメンバーは、SQL Server インフラストラクチャをサポートしています。 (SfcObjectExtender<TSfcInstance> から継承されています。)
プロテクト メソッド parent_PropertyMetadataChanged PropertyMetadata 内の親オブジェクトを示します。このメンバーをコード内で直接参照しないでください。このメンバーは、SQL Server インフラストラクチャをサポートしています。 (SfcObjectExtender<TSfcInstance> から継承されています。)
プロテクト メソッド RegisterParentProperty プロパティ コレクションに含まれていない親のプロパティを登録します。このメンバーをコード内で直接参照しないでください。このメンバーは、SQL Server インフラストラクチャをサポートしています。 (SfcObjectExtender<TSfcInstance> から継承されています。)
プロテクト メソッド RegisterProperty(PropertyInfo) 反映された追加のプロパティを登録します。このメンバーをコード内で直接参照しないでください。このメンバーは、SQL Server インフラストラクチャをサポートしています。 (SfcObjectExtender<TSfcInstance> から継承されています。)
プロテクト メソッド RegisterProperty(PropertyInfo, String) このメンバーをコード内で直接参照しないでください。このメンバーは、SQL Server インフラストラクチャをサポートしています。 (SfcObjectExtender<TSfcInstance> から継承されています。)
パブリック メソッド ToString (Object から継承されています。)
パブリック メソッド Validate サーバー監査の仕様について、指定されたパラメーターで指定したメソッドを検証します。

先頭に戻る

イベント

  名前 説明
パブリック イベント PropertyChanged このメンバーをコード内で直接参照しないでください。このメンバーは、SQL Server インフラストラクチャをサポートしています。 (SfcObjectExtender<TSfcInstance> から継承されています。)
パブリック イベント PropertyMetadataChanged このメンバーをコード内で直接参照しないでください。このメンバーは、SQL Server インフラストラクチャをサポートしています。 (SfcObjectExtender<TSfcInstance> から継承されています。)

先頭に戻る

スレッド セーフ

この型の public static (Visual Basic では Shared) のメンバーはすべて、スレッド セーフです。インスタンス メンバーの場合は、スレッド セーフであるとは限りません。

関連項目

参照

Microsoft.SqlServer.Management.Smo 名前空間